It’s about the story and survival in concentration and extermination camps during the holocaust in Poland in Auschwitz.

There are 3 phases of mental reactions to camp/prisoners life: Shock, Apathy and the psychology of the prisoners after his liberation.

While reading this, I can’t imagine the suffering they all been through… and in this book it will also enlighten you that even in those times of suffering, you will also find the meaning and purpose of life.

If you are also into psychology, it will explain about psychoanalysis and it’s difference to Logotheraphy. There are just some hard to understand psychology terms/explanations on the last part of the book.

Here are some lines that I love in this book: ( I cannot put everything kasi super dami actually hehe)

1. “Everything can be taken from a man but one thing: the last of the human freedoms-to choose one’s attitude in any given set of circumstances, to choose one’s own way.”

2. “An active life serves the purpose of giving man the opportunity to realize values in creative work, while a passive life of enjoyment affords him the opportunity to obtain fulfillment in experiencing beauty, art or nature.”

3. “the meaning of life, differ from man to man and from moment to moment. Thus it is impossible to define the meaning of life in general way.”

Japanese Ways that teach us about life:

KINTSUGI - a reminder to stay optimistic when things fall apart and to celebrate/accept the flaws and missteps of life.

ICHICO ICHIE - treasuring the unrepeatable nature of a moment or once in a lifetime.

WABI SABI - The appreciation of the beauty of imperfection, impermanence, and simplicity as the natural state of things in the world

IKIGAI - You reason for being, your life purpose.

Have you found your Ikigai?

It’s your Passion, Mission, Profession & Vocation in life. ( swife for more info)

There are also 10 rules of Ikigai:

1.) Stay active, don’t retire - keep doing the things that you still love

2.) Take it slow

3.) Don’t fill your stomach - eat a little less than our hunger demand

4.) surround yourself with good friends

5.) get in shape for your next birthday

6.) Smile

7.) Reconnect with nature

8.) Give thanks

9.) Live in the moment

10.) Follow your ikigai
